How much do junior project eng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 31, 2026, the average yearly pay for junior project engineer in the United States is $71,799.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$48,500.00 and $80,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the typical responsibilities of a Junior Project Engineer on a project team?

As a Junior Project Engineer, you will often support senior engineers and project managers by assisting with project planning, coordinating schedules, preparing documentation, and liaising with contractors or vendors. Your daily tasks may include updating project timelines, monitoring progress, and ensuring that technical standards are met. This role typically involves collaborating closely with cross-functional teams, attending meetings, and occasionally visiting job sites to track project status. It's an excellent entry point for developing technical expertise and project management skills within an engineering environment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Junior Project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Junior Project Engineer, you need a solid understanding of engineering principles, project management basics, and a relevant bachelor's degree in engineering. Familiarity with project management software (like MS Project or Primavera), CAD tools, and sometimes certifications like EIT (Engineer in Training) are typically required. Strong communication, problem-solving, and teamwork skills help you effectively coordinate with diverse project stakeholders. These skills and qualifications are crucial for delivering successful projects on time and within budget while supporting senior engineers and learning on the job.

What is the difference between Junior Project Engineer vs Project Coordinator?

AspectJunior Project EngineerProject Coordinator
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Engineering or related field, some certificationsBachelor's degree, often in business or related field
Work EnvironmentEngineering teams, construction sites, project planningAdministrative offices, project management teams
Employer & Industry UsageConstruction, engineering, manufacturingConstruction, IT, event planning

Junior Project Engineers focus on technical and engineering tasks within projects, often working closely with engineers and technical teams. Project Coordinators handle administrative and logistical aspects, supporting project managers. Both roles are essential but differ in technical involvement and responsibilities.

What does a Junior Project Engineer do?

A Junior Project Engineer assists in planning, coordinating, and executing engineering projects under the supervision of senior engineers. Their responsibilities typically include preparing project documentation, conducting research, supporting design and implementation tasks, and communicating with team members and stakeholders. They often help monitor project progress, ensure compliance with safety and quality standards, and address technical issues as they arise. This role is ideal for recent engineering graduates looking to gain practical experience and develop their project management skills.

Job description

About the Role

Seeking a tech-savvy junior project manager to support hospitality renovation and capital improvement projects from preconstruction through closeout. You'll start by learning our estimating fundamentals, then grow into full project manager. Perfect for someone who picks up software fast, loves construction tech, and wants to build a career, not just hold a job.

What You'll Do

· Assist Project Managers with daily project coordination

· Manage submittals, RFIs, and change order documentation

· Track project schedules and update logs

· Attend OAC meetings and document action items

· Coordinate with subcontractors, architects, and suppliers

Estimating & Cost Support

· Read and evaluate architectural/engineering drawings

· Perform basic quantity takeoffs using digital tools

· Build cost spreadsheets in Excel/Google Sheets

· Research material/labor pricing for budget updates

· Support Project Managers on ROM estimates and construction execution

Tech & Software

· Master construction management platforms: Builder Trend, Bluebeam, ProCore

· Build and maintain Excel cost trackers with formulas

· Fast learner of new estimating software, this role is tech-heavy

· Maintain digital project records and documentation

Growth Path

· Year 1: Jr Project Engineer + estimating fundamentals

· Year 2–3: Full project engineering responsibility with Sr. Project Manager oversite

· Year 4+: Project Manager track (client-facing, budget ownership)

What We're Looking For

Required

· 1–3 years construction experience (Project Engineer, coordinator, or internship)

· Comfortable learning new software quickly

· Strong Excel skills (formulas, pivot tables, data organization)

· Detail-oriented with documentation habits

· Clear communicator (emails, meeting notes, logs)

· Thrives in fast-paced renovation environment
